Academic Comparison between Geneva and Moore College

Geneva College and Moore College of Art and Design are frequently compared when students or parents prepare college admissions. Both Schools are four-year, private (not-for-profit) and located in Pennsylvania

Comparison at a Glance

The following list compares two colleges briefly in important perspectives. You can compare them with comprehensive information on full comparison page.

  • Both schools are four-year, private (not-for-profit) schools.
  • Moore College has more expensive tuition & fees ($52,674) than Geneva ($33,450).
  • Geneva has more students with 1,366 students while Moore College has 549 students.
  • Moore College has a lower number of students per faculty with 9 to 1 while Geneva's ratio is 15 to 1.
  • Geneva has more full-time faculties with 64 faculties while Moore College has 22 full-time faculties.
